llm_review
An AI model (anthropic/claude-4.6-sonnet-20260217) reviewed this and agrees it is MEDIUM (confidence 72%): The package downloads a prebuilt binary .deb from the project's own domain (finalcrypt.org) rather than from a verifiable source like GitHub releases or a distribution mirror. The .deb contains executed code (a Java application with native dependencies) and there is no source build. The sha256sum pins a specific file, which mitigates casual tampering, but the host is a personal project site with no transparency about build provenance. This is a genuine supply-chain concern: if finalcrypt.org is compromised or the maintainer silently replaces the file, users execute arbitrary code. However, this is a common AUR pattern for closed/binary packages and the URL is the official project website, so it is not clearly malicious — correctly rated medium.
PKGBUILD
1 offending line(s) highlighted# Maintainer: iamawacko <iamawacko@protonmail.com>
# Contributor: Dimitris Kiziridis <ragouel at outlook dot com>
pkgname=finalcrypt
pkgver=6.8.0
pkgrel=1
pkgdesc="The World's Strongest Encryption"
arch=('x86_64')
url='http://www.finalcrypt.org'
license=('CCPL')
depends=('java-runtime>=8'
'gtk2'
'libnet'
'ffmpeg'
'gtk3')
makedepends=('tar')
source=("${pkgname}-${pkgver}.deb::http://www.finalcrypt.org/downloads/linux/finalcrypt_linux_x86_64_debian_based.deb")
sha256sums=('f6df42b3ff05dced53efc33760028d62375e52fc7a1988790e54a670073e891c')
package() {
tar xvf data.tar.xz -C "${pkgdir}/"
install -Dm644 "${pkgdir}/opt/FinalCrypt/FinalCrypt.desktop" "${pkgdir}/usr/share/applications/${pkgname}.desktop"
rm "${pkgdir}/opt/FinalCrypt/FinalCrypt.desktop"
}
